Fuel Cells

Fuel cells are electrochemical devices that combines hydrogen fuel and oxygen from the air to produce DC electricity, heat and water. Hydrogen will be reformed internally utilizing the biomethane provided from the biogas fuel from BioFuels Energy's Mobile Renewable Energy Process. The DC power will be converted to renewable AC power for use by the Customer. The fuel cells are intended to serve the Customer as a base load electrical energy application and are generally sized to meet the Customers minimum energy demand. These larger fuel cells operate in excess of ninety percent of nameplate capacity.

Fuel cells operate without combustion, so they are virtually pollution free resulting in a 97% reduction in NOX and CO. Since the fuel is converted directly to electricity, a fuel cell can operate at much higher efficiencies than internal combustion engines, extracting more electricity from the same amount of fuel. The fuel cell itself has no moving parts, and in many ways can be thought of as a large battery, making it quiet and a reliable source of green power.
